Airports face chaos after America bans UNCHARGED mobiles or laptops from US-bound flights over bomb fears The US has declared that it will not allow mobile phones - especially iPhones and Samsungs Galaxy - onto US bound planes from some airports in Europe, the Middle East and Africa if the devices are not charged. The new measure, which is bound to cause chaotic scenes at airports around the globe, is part of the US Transportation Security Administrations effort to boost surveillance amid concerns that terrorists are plotting to blow up an airliner. As part of the increased scrutiny at certain airports, security agents may ask travelers to turn on their electronic devices at checkpoints and if they do not have power, the devices will not be allowed on planes, the TSA said. dailymail.co.uk/news/article-2682478/Airports-facing-chaos-US-declares-wont-allow-uncharged-cellphones-laptops-flights-bound-America.html
